Crawl Space Solutions
In our area, many of the homes were built with crawl spaces in addition to basements. For a long time, these were created with open vents to the outside where were intended to help fresh air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. The vents allow water to enter the space when it rains or snows and the vents hinder airflow which results in the humidity level staying too high which will eventually facilitate the growth of mildew. Studies have shown that up to 50% of the air in your home has come up through the crawl space so ensuring this area is protected from the elements and controlling excess humidity will improve the overall air quality in your home.
JB Design has been enclosing crawl spaces since 1995 and we know the proper way to seal them off and control excess humidity. We do this using a method called enc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, occasionally installed with insulation products, which are thick plastic and vinyl sheets as well as vent covers and a heavy duty door that will close off the area completely and prevent any unwanted moisture from entering. This will also prevent critters and animals from getting in your crawl space which will keep any appliances there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After your crawl space is encapsulated, if you need it we will install a series of floor jacks to lift sloping floors in your home.
Structural Foundation Repair
Your foundation is quite possibly one of, if not the, most important areas of the home. It not only holds the building itself but it also is the basement walls. When there are foundation problems, normally they will manifest themselves as diagonal cracks in your outside brickwork, horizontal cracks that run the length of the foundation or along bas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that your windows and doors will not open or close easily or there may be cracks at the corners of them. While these issues may not seem critical when you notice them, they are all indicative of a sinking or settling foundation and it is important to have an expert evaluate the foundation for problems and determine what type of a repair needs to be performed.
It is good that the most common foundation problems are caused by similar things and our professionals are very good at noticing these problems. We can implement a repair solution designed for your specific issue to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ation. If the problem is a sinking foundation, we will implement a series of foundation piers to correct the problem. The location and amount of sinking will determine if we use helical or push piers. Both types of piers are very strong and can stabilize your foundation.
